Even a well-designed survey does not simply capture what people think and do. What gets in the way?

Hints
  1. Ask how honestly people report their drinking.
  2. Then ask whether "forbid" and "not allow" get the same answers.
Show the answer

B. Social desirability and question wording

Why

The instrument participates in the answer. This is why surveys are cross-checked against behavioural data and why question wording is itself a research literature.
